This is a really great experience to share with friends. About 2 hours in total, including a 15-20 minutes break mid-way. (No photographs allowed during the experience itself, only in the themed reception bar & toilets, and the mid-way Survivors’ Bar.) The actors are brilliantly engaging throughout, and the interactive plot keeps you enthralled. The second half was particularly good. I’m a 60 year old guy and consider myself to be reasonably fit, but there is a fair bit of agility required to negotiate the set. (Although I’m sure that the lovely staff would help you bypass any obstacle that you feel uncomfortable with in tackling.) A great way to spend a couple of hours, and good value for money compared with other London experiences.
